Cascada is a black (advanced) run at Estación de esquí de Candanchú measuring 408 m, dropping 141 m from 2127 m down to 1986 m. It averages a 33.1% gradient, steepening to around 73.9% at its most sustained pitch.
Snowboard-friendly: no significant flat or uphill sections detected along the descent.
Watch for 2 uphill sections: 25 m of climb about 50 m in; 25 m of climb about 100 m in.
